Hill ApoEdp inhibited capillary tubule formation (<i>in vitro</i> angiogenesis). Public Library of Science 2013 inhibited capillary tubule 2013-02-20 21:24:53 Figure https://plos.figshare.com/articles/figure/_ApoEdp_inhibited_capillary_tubule_formation_in_vitro_angiogenesis_/478140 <p>About 4×10<sup>4</sup> (per well) HUVECs in medium containing 50 ng/mL of VEGF were plated in 24-well plates previously coated with growth factor-reduced matrigel, and incubated for 12–16 hr at 37°C in the absence or presence of apoEdp. Tubular structures were quantitated by manual counting under low power fields. Representative photomicrographs of tubule formation in the (A) VEGF control and (B) apoEdp-treated wells are shown. (C) “Percentage (%) of inhibition” is the mean number (± SEM) of tubules expressed as a proportion of that in the VEGF control group. ** p<0.01 and *** p<0.001.</p>
